History
Benicia was California's third state capital from 1853 to 1854, with the original State Capitol building still standing on First Street, now a State Historic Park.
The city was founded in 1847 by Robert Semple and Thomas O. Larkin, and named after Semple's wife, Francisca Benicia Carrillo de Vallejo, wife of General Mariano Guadalupe Vallejo.
During the Gold Rush, Benicia served as a vital port and military outpost, housing the Benicia Arsenal, a major U.S. Army ordnance facility until its closure in 1964.
Life in Benicia
Benicia boasts a strong sense of community, evident in its popular events like the annual Benicia Farmers' Market, the Torchlight Parade and Fireworks display on the Fourth of July, and the downtown First Street Art Walks. The city fosters a vibrant arts scene, with numerous artists' studios and galleries contributing to a dynamic creative atmosphere.
Buyer Profile
Benicia attracts a diverse mix of buyers, from tech professionals commuting to Silicon Valley or San Francisco seeking a more relaxed lifestyle and better value, to families drawn by the strong school district and community feel. Retirees also appreciate its quiet charm, waterfront access, and proximity to healthcare services. Many are Bay Area residents 'cashing out' of more expensive markets like Berkeley or Marin County to find more space and a lower cost of living without leaving the region entirely.
Market Trends
Benicia's real estate market remains competitive, reflecting the broader Bay Area trends but often at a slightly more accessible price point than its southern neighbors. Home values have continued to appreciate steadily over the past few years, though not at the explosive rates seen in San Francisco or Silicon Valley. The median home price typically hovers in the high $700,000s to low $900,000s, with a significant demand for properties between 1,500 and 2,500 square feet. Inventory often remains low, leading to multiple offers, especially for well-maintained homes with water views. There are no large-scale new developments currently impacting the core housing supply, though individual custom builds and minor infill projects occur.

Why People Move to Benicia
<strong>Commute Accessibility:</strong> While not on BART, Benicia offers relatively easier commutes via I-780, I-680, and I-80 to job centers in Walnut Creek, Oakland, and even San Francisco (approximately 35-50 miles, depending on traffic), making it attractive for Bay Area professionals seeking more affordable housing and a calmer lifestyle.
<strong>Excellent Schools:</strong> The Benicia Unified School District is highly regarded, with schools like Robert Semple Elementary and Benicia High School consistently performing well, attracting families prioritizing strong public education.
<strong>Outdoor Recreation:</strong> With its waterfront location, residents enjoy kayaking, paddleboarding, and fishing in the Carquinez Strait, while access to the Benicia State Recreation Area and nearby parks provides ample opportunities for hiking and biking.
<strong>Historic Charm & Arts Scene:</strong> The city's preserved Victorian architecture and a thriving community of artists and galleries, particularly in the Benicia Arsenal, provide a unique cultural richness that belies its relatively smaller size.
